Mazda 3 Service Manual: Front Side Marker/Front Turn Light Bulb Removal/Installation

Mazda 3 Service Manual / Body / Lighting & Horn / Exterior / Front Side Marker/Front Turn Light Bulb Removal/Installation

1. Disconnect the negative battery cable..

2. Slightly bend back the front mudguard..

3. Rotate the front side marker/front turn light socket in the direction of the arrow shown in the figure.


4. Remove the front side marker/front turn light bulb.


5. Install in the reverse order of removal.
